Here is a summary of how it went down with the dealership.
At first the dealership tried to make my own insurance cover the cost of the car and repay me through them but I had told my insurance to put a hold on my claim because I believed it was the dealerships fault that my car had caught on fire. An investigation concluded that the source of the fire was fuel related and soon afterwards the dealership's insurance contacted me thru my lawyer and it took a while but things finally settled. The dealership did not set me up with my new BRZ, I had to look thru the subaru dealerships in socal until I had found one without markups. From the time my old car burnt down to when the dealership's insurance had paid me, I had a rental car from enterprise that was paid for by the dealership. and about the color, WRB has always been my favorite color. SWP was a close second and a SWP came up before a WRB did when I was first looking for a BRZ so i pulled the trigger on the SWP |
